Book of Matthew Chapter 17 - Read Chapter 17:1 - [In Context ]Six days later, Jesus took Peter, James, and John the brother of James and went up on a high mountain. They were all alone there.
17:2 - [In Context ]While these followers watched him, Jesus was changed. His face became bright like the sun. And his clothes became white as light.
17:3 - [In Context ]Then two men were there, talking with Jesus. The men were Moses and Elijah. F236
17:4 - [In Context ]Peter said to Jesus, "Lord, it is good that we are here. If you want, I will put three tents here--one for you, one for Moses, and one for Elijah."
17:5 - [In Context ]While Peter was talking, a bright cloud came over them. A voice came from the cloud. The voice said, "This (Jesus) is my Son and I love him. I am very pleased with him. Obey him!"
17:6 - [In Context ]The followers with Jesus heard this voice. They were very afraid, so they fell to the ground.
17:7 - [In Context ]But Jesus came to the followers and touched them. Jesus said, "Stand up. Don't be afraid."
17:8 - [In Context ]The followers looked up, and they saw Jesus was now alone.
17:9 - [In Context ]Jesus and the followers were walking down the mountain. Jesus commanded the followers, "Don't tell any person about the things you saw on the mountain. Wait until the Son of Man F237 has been raised from death. Then you can tell people about what you saw."
17:10 - [In Context ]The followers asked Jesus, "Why do the teachers of the law say that Elijah F238 must come F239 first {before the Christ F240 comes}?"
17:11 - [In Context ]Jesus answered, "They are right to say that Elijah is coming. And it is true that Elijah will make all things the way they should be.
17:12 - [In Context ]But I tell you, Elijah has already come. People did not know who he was. People did to him all the {bad} things they wanted to do. It is the same with the Son of Man. F241 Those same people will make the Son of Man suffer."
17:13 - [In Context ]Then the followers understood that Jesus meant that John the Baptizer was really Elijah.
FOOTNOTES: F236: Moses and Elijah Two important Jewish leaders in the past.
F237: Son of Man A name Jesus used for himself. In Dan. 7:13-14, this is the name for the Messiah, the one God chose to save his people.
F238: Elijah A man that spoke for God about 850 B.C.
F239: Elijah must come See Mal. 4:5-6.
F240: Christ The "anointed one" (Messiah) or chosen one of God.
